Natural Bug Deterrents



To keep pests far from your garden normally, plant aromatic natural herbs like mint and lavender. These aromatic plants not only add charm to your yard however additionally act as reliable bug deterrents. Parasites like insects, flies, and even some garden-damaging bugs are warded off by the solid aromas sent out by these natural herbs. Just placing them purposefully around your garden can aid develop a natural obstacle versus unwanted bugs.

In addition to mint and lavender, take into consideration planting various other herbs like rosemary, basil, and lemongrass to better improve your garden's pest-proofing capabilities. These natural herbs not only serve as natural repellents however also have actually the included benefit of working in cooking or crafting homemade solutions.

Reliable Insect Control Techniques



For combating yard pests efficiently, executing a multi-faceted bug control method is vital. Start by urging all-natural predators like birds, ladybugs, and praying mantises to aid keep insect populaces in check. Introducing plants that draw in these useful pests can aid in insect control. Additionally, practicing excellent garden health by removing debris and weeds where insects may conceal can make your garden less hospitable to undesirable site visitors.

Consider using physical obstacles such as row cover textiles or netting to safeguard vulnerable plants from bugs like caterpillars and birds. Using natural chemicals like neem oil or insecticidal soap can additionally be effective against certain pests while being much less unsafe to valuable pests and the setting. It's essential to rotate your crops each season to avoid the buildup of insect populations that target particular plants.

Consistently evaluate your plants for indications of parasite damages so you can take action without delay. By incorporating these methods and remaining alert, you can successfully control yard parasites and delight in a thriving, pest-free yard.
